A legal challenge is set to proceed in Australia’s Federal Court seeking to halt Woodside’s gas project extension. Multiple outlets report that the dispute centres on the federal government’s decision to approve a 40-year extension for Australia’s largest gas project, operated by Woodside. The matter is described as a contest over whether the extension should be allowed to proceed under the applicable approvals framework.
The reporting indicates the bid is scheduled to head to court, with the action raised after the government grants the long-term extension.
